Saturday, August 15, 2009

Where might Them Crooked Vultures play next?

John Paul Jones, Dave Grohl and front man Josh Homme debuted their new band, Them Crooked Vultures, in concert during the first 80 minutes of Aug. 10. Following the set, there was no announcement of any further concerts.

However, a cryptic use of Google Earth on the band's official Web site soon led fans to believe a location would be revealed. So far, the location has centered on western Europe, including where two music festivals are taking place 200 km apart from each other in neighboring countries Belgium and the Netherlands.

For a larger map, click here.

No comments:

Post a Comment

Comments are moderated prior to publication. Comments will not be published if they are deemed vulgar, defamatory or otherwise objectionable.